Here are a few procedures and suggestions for your belt test. Keep them in mind!
1. Arrive at the time and place announced for the test. Be dressed in your uniform and bring the fee. Cash or check only. If you can't afford to pay at test time you may test and pay later, but the belt will not be awarded till the fee has been paid.

2. Fill out a test sheet. Doing this early will save you time standing in line.
Sheets are available at the test or you may tear out one of the sheets in this handbook and use it.
Make sure to fill out all the personal information, including belt size.
(This is usually the same size as your uniform)
3. Use the time before the test to warm-up and stretch.
When testing begins a brief explanation of procedures will be given,
then your name will be called by a judge.
Answer "Yes Sir" or "Yes Ma'am" and run to stand before the judge.
Bow when appropriate.
4. After the test, if you have passed, you will be awarded your new belt. Turn your back to the judge, remove your old belt but do NOT drop it onto the floor. Belts are treated like the flag, with respect. Hang your old belt around your neck and put on your new belt. Then turn around to face your judge. Congratulations! After a couple weeks you will receive a certificate of rank as well as your graded test sheet. Use this to help you identify areas where you need more work.
